Proper insulation plays a major role in maintaining indoor comfort, improving energy efficiency, and protecting a home's structure. Over time, insulation can become damaged, contaminated, or less effective due to age, moisture, pests, or settling. When this happens, homeowners often hear about two services: insulation removal and insulation replacement. While these terms are related, they serve different purposes and are important parts of improving a home's insulation system.
Understanding the difference between the two can help homeowners make informed decisions about their property's energy performance and comfort.
Insulation removal is the process of safely extracting existing insulation from areas such as attics, crawl spaces, and wall cavities. This service is often necessary when insulation has become damaged, contaminated, or ineffective.

Rodents and pests may nest within insulation materials, leaving behind contamination that affects indoor air quality. Mold growth can also develop when moisture becomes trapped within insulation.
In some cases, insulation simply reaches the end of its useful life. Older materials may compress, settle, or deteriorate over time, making them less effective at regulating indoor temperatures.
Professional insulation removal ensures that old materials are safely extracted and properly disposed of while preparing the space for future improvements.
Insulation replacement involves installing new insulation after old materials have been removed. The goal is to restore or improve a home's thermal performance, energy efficiency, and overall comfort.
Replacement insulation may include modern materials such as spray foam, fiberglass, or cellulose. The best option depends on the home's construction, climate conditions, and energy-efficiency goals.
Many homeowners choose insulation replacement because newer insulation products often provide better thermal resistance and air-sealing performance than older materials. This can help reduce energy waste and improve temperature consistency throughout the home.
When performed correctly, replacement insulation creates a more efficient building envelope that helps homeowners stay comfortable during both cold winters and warm summers.
The primary difference is that insulation removal focuses on taking out old or damaged materials, while insulation replacement focuses on installing new insulation to improve performance.
Think of insulation removal as the preparation stage and replacement as the upgrade stage.
Removal addresses issues such as contamination, moisture damage, pest infestations, and deteriorated materials. Replacement then provides a fresh insulation system that helps improve energy efficiency and indoor comfort.
In many situations, the two services work together. Once damaged insulation is removed, new insulation can be installed to maximize the benefits of the project.

Insulation that has absorbed moisture often loses its insulating properties. Wet insulation can also contribute to mold growth and structural concerns.
Rodents and insects can damage insulation and create unhealthy conditions within attics and crawl spaces.
When mold develops within insulation materials, removal is often necessary to help restore a healthier indoor environment.
Older insulation may no longer provide adequate thermal protection, resulting in higher energy bills and reduced comfort.
